将日期时间字符串(3/24/2017 10:00:00 PM)转换为(3-24-2017 22:00:00)配置单元,即从12小时格式转换为24小时格式

擎天柱

我在蜂巢表中有一个datetime字段,它是数据类型字符串。

它看起来如下:

datetime 3/24/2017 10:00:00 PM

试图将其转换为蜂巢所需的正确格式,并尝试将AM / PM删除为24小时格式,但无济于事。

select from_unixtime(unix_timestamp(datetime,'mm-dd-yyyy HH:MM:SS')) from test_table
迪帕克·肖

您可以使用以下命令实现此目的:

select from_unixtime(unix_timestamp(datetime,'MM/dd/yyyy hh:mm:ss aa'),'MM-dd-yyyy HH:mm:ss') from test_table;

本文收集自互联网,转载请注明来源。

如有侵权,请联系 [email protected] 删除。

编辑于
0

我来说两句

0 条评论
登录 后参与评论

相关文章